#d11444 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d11444 is composed of 82% red, 7.8%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.4% magenta, 67.5%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 344.8 degrees, a saturation of 82.5% and a lightness of 44.9%. #d11444 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2888 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#d11444 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d11444 has RGB values of R:209, G:20,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.9, Y:0.67,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13702212.

Hex triplet d11444 #d11444
RGB Decimal 209, 20, 68 rgb(209,20,68)
RGB Percent 82, 7.8, 26.7 rgb(82%,7.8%,26.7%)
CMYK 0, 90, 67, 18
HSL 344.8°, 82.5, 44.9 hsl(344.8,82.5%,44.9%)
HSV (or HSB) 344.8°, 90.4, 82
Web Safe cc0033 #cc0033
CIE-LAB 44.909, 68.521, 25.626
XYZ 27.589, 14.476, 6.81
xyY 0.564, 0.296, 14.476
CIE-LCH 44.909, 73.156, 20.505
CIE-LUV 44.909, 127.471, 13.432
Hunter-Lab 38.048, 62.85, 16.021
Binary 11010001, 00010100, 01000100

Shades and Tints of #d11444

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0104 is the darkest color, while #fef9f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d11444

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#796c6f is the less saturated color, while #e3023b is the most saturated one.
